The Minister of Humanitarian Affairs and Poverty Alleviation, Betta Edu, has said that the N585m fraud allegation against her is an attempt to tarnish her image. Recall that the minister came under heavy criticism on Friday after a memo surfaced where she directed the Accountant-General of the Federation, Oluwatoyin Madein, to transfer N585 million to a private account owned by one Oniyelu Bridget.
Clarifying the viral memo, the ministry said that Oniyelu Bridget is the Project Accountant in the ministry and the money was for grants for Vulnerable Groups.

There is no coat of arms on the flask, but somewhere in one of Britain’s hospitals a convalescent patient has some of the world’s most exclusive blood flowing through his or her veins. The regal donor of the precious stuff was Prince Charles, 36, who has become the first member of the royal family ever to give blood, in his case, O Rh-negative.

Source: TikTok/@averiebishopThe Fyre Festival of 2017 was a debacle that will most likely never be forgotten. The fraudulent event was founded by a con artist named Billy McFarland who promised social media influencers the weekend of their lives –– if they were willing to shell out thousands of dollars. Upon arrival, guests quickly learned that the festival was a total scam filled with endless problems.
